FOF4: Game killing bug? -- HELP!

Ugh..

I've loaded up FOF4 for the first time.. I went in and per what Bee had done, I started in 1987 with an OPU 20 mil salary cap in order to sim through 2002 and start my season..

I'm on 2002, saving after every season on auto, and all of a sudden I go to the amateur draft and there are NO players... So if i tell the scout to draft, it bombs the game..

If I load up my saved copy, and it does the same thing..

ANyone seen this, know how to fix this?

I could import a TCY draft for one year... that will mess up balance some, but not a major thing.. except i don't want to have to do this every year..

I had the same thing. I didn't create a player in the draft part initially and had assumed that was the problem. You would think it would mess up the first year, but it didn't.

I used a TCY draft file and the following season the game generated draft was fine.
